2026 Michigan Super Lawyers and Rising Stars

2026 Michigan Super Lawyers and Rising Stars

Super Lawyers has published its annual listing of Michigan attorneys who have distinguished themselves in the practice of law. Fifteen (15) lawyers from Kotz Sangster offices in Detroit and Bloomfield Hills have been honored by their peers as 2026 Super Lawyers and Rising Stars. Widely recognized as a rating service of outstanding lawyers, Super Lawyers highlights attorneys from 75 practice areas who have attained a high degree of peer recognition and professional achievement.

Of special note are the Michigan Super Lawyer recognitions for healthcare attorney Keith Soltis and business litigation attorney Dennis Egan. Both have been honored for 20 consecutive years. Additionally, environmental law attorney Nicholas (Nick) Tatro has been recognized as a Michigan Super Lawyer, and construction law attorney Isidoro (Sid) Spano has been recognized as a Michigan Rising Star. Both are new recognitions.
